Mira was still glaring at everyone, waiting for there response. They all just stayed still and silent. No one and I mean no one wanted to get on the She-devils bad side, especially if you're going to have to be with her everyday.
She sighed knowing that no one wanted to tell her. "Fine then," she said, "At least tell me who started it." She crossed her arms. Everyone instantly pointed at Natsu and backed away. She had a devious glare with a smile that would scare the shit out of someone. "Natsu, care to explain?" She asked in a soft voice.
"It wasn't me I swear, it was gajeel—" he pointed in his direction, "—he threw food at me and I was just getting payback. Until. . . I accidentally hit Lucy and it kept hitting other people until, this." He spread his arms to emphasize them. Mira took a good look at everyone and saw them dripping, from head to toe, in her cooking. She looked at the tables too and saw them covered in food stains, some cutlery and plates were broken and some chairs were tipped over or in really weird places.
'Probably ran out of food.' Mira thought to herself.
"It wasn't me, for the millionth time!" Gajeel yelled. "Then who was it?" Natsu snobbishly asked. "I don't know." He shrugged. "T — that might of been me." Gray slouched and raised his hand slightly. Everyone started backing away from him, not want to feel Miras wrath. "I kinda, sorta lost a bit of my food. I was talking and some food flew out of my spoon and might've landed on your face."
"So it was your fault!" Natsu accused, pointing a finger at gray. "I guess," He sheepishly replied. "I don't care who started it," Some black magic started coming out from around her. "You all took part of it, so you're all going to pay." She replied darkly.
Advertisement
A flash of black light emitted from her and she transformed into her sitri satan souls. Flames surrounded her and she still had a fierce glare on, which made this even scarier. Natsu and Gray ended up hugging each other out of fear.
"Now then," She said in her scariest voice. "Are you two ready for your punishment?" She smirked while the others were trying to hold back their laugh; they knew what ever she had planned would suck for Gray and Natsu.
The two of them could only gulp in anticipation. They were still shivering and hugging each other.
"We," She pointed to the three of them, "Are going to play the masters game." They sighed a little in relief, they thought they had at least a little chance to survive the game, one of them could be the master. "Except. . ." They shivered in fear again. "I'm always going to be the master," The two fell on the floor and turned white, you could see their souls coming out of their bodies.
Mira cackled like crazy and sat down on a random chair, crossing her legs and resting her hand on her head. She looked like a ruthless queen about to give someone severe punishment — but in a way, that was what she was doing. She held up a popsicle stick and showed it to the two of them with her free hand, flaunting it. "Bow." She strictly ordered. Out of sheer fear the two of them sat down on their knees, hands on their lap.
'What the hell are we doing?' Natsu and Gray both thought to themselves. They thought they looked stupid following her orders (Which they did) and wanted to stop. They looked up only to see Mira staring down at them mockingly.
"Let's start."
